>>> First of all, I need to identify this section, because, like I said,
>>> it's being added only once to a single object file. When some group is seen
>>> next time, all member sections are discarded. This means that relocations
>>> in some object file may point to discarded sections. When you see this
>>> discarded section in GC, you should (IMHO) find it counterpart and mark it
>>> live.

>> No, I don't think relocations could point to sections that were removed
>> because of comdat group deduplication.

> I'm sorry but this does happen. I can't share the real world example, but
> you can try the test case which is a part of this patch (comdat-gc.s).
> You'll get a crash in forEachSuccessor.
>

But isn't it out of the spec?

>> All relocations to sections in comdat groups should be through undefined
>> symbols. So, when the control reaches this part of code, all symbols should
>> have already been resolved, or it will end up with a link error. You
>> shouldn't have to "resolve" comdat groups by name again here.

> What I'm doing now is:
>>>
>>> a) Get group signature, given object file and some input section index.
>>> This is done using SectionGroupSig hash map.
>>> b) Store all group signatures in hash set
>>> c) Iterate object files and fetch all input sections, which are members
>>> of comdat groups with signatures in this hash set.
>>>
>>> Now I'm trying to understand your suggestion. You suggest to keep list
>>> of member sections in each member of the group, correct?
>>> You cannot do so in discarded section, so you still need to find real
>>> section, having some object file and section number in it, right?

>>>> Imagine any section that is in some comdat group have a GroupMembers
>>>> vector, so that starting from any comdat group member section, you can
>>>> reach all siblings in the same group. With that, all you have to do for a
>>>> section S to make all its siblings live is to do `for (InputSectionData
>>>> *Succ : S->GroupMember) Enque({Succ, 0});`. Doesn't it work?

>>>>> Let's elaborate the idea. The main problem is that symbol 'D' inside
>>>>> resolveReloc() may point to InputSectionBase<ELFT>::Discarded. This
>>>>> happens because comdat group is added to only one object file and causes
>>>>> crash in GC, because forEachSuccessor implicitly casts Discarded to
>>>>> InputSection<ELFT> and tries to fetch relocs from it. How this
>>>>> 'GroupMembers' vector would help?
